The Medieval period saw major technological advances, including the invention of vertical windmills, spectacles, mechanical clocks, greatly improved water mills, building techniques like the Gothic style and three-field crop rotation. In medieval period, the largest trebuchets (with throwing arms 50 feet in length and ~20,000 lbs counterweight) could throw stones 200-300 lbs to a distance of about 1000 feet. WeP Solutions Ltd was started as a public limited company in March 1995 under the name of Datanet Corporation Ltd. It was later renamed as WeP Solutions Ltd . The company came out with a successful IPO in the year 2000. The shares of the company are listed with Bombay Stock Exchange Limited, Mumbai.
